“Fearing the Lord is the beginning of moral knowledge, but fools despise wisdom and instruction.”  “…then you will understand how to fear the Lord, and you will discover knowledge about God.”  Proverbs 1:7 & 2:5 NET   The fear of the Lord is something that as a Christian we grow up with as part of our vocabulary and understanding.  For those that have not grown-up in the Church this concept can be hard at times to understand.  We have had two long discussions on this idea in the Friday noon discipleship group.  The prevailing thought is that the more you know and understand someone or something the less fear you have.  This is basically true in most cases, so why should we fear God?  We fear God because of who He is, what He has done, and what He will do.  Moses told the people of Israel that God appeared on the mountain in such an awesome manner in order that they would not sin.  Because God is so awesome we are both drawn to Him as a creator and redeemer, and we are driven back from him in dread when we realize our sinfulness and His righteousness.  These are concepts and feelings that cannot be just taught, but must be experienced as we come to know God.  Let us desire to know God better that we might worship His awesomeness that both inspires and humbles us.   Thank you for praying for Ted Skiles.  His doctor is very pleased with the result of the first surgery.  Ted is to return to see the doctor again in a month.  A second surgery will be set-up at that time.   We continue to ask that you pray for Ellinor’s adoption to be completed soon.  We need God to work on the hearts of people that can make a difference in the case.  We can only guess at this point why the report on the home study for the mom has not been completed and filed.  We do know that this is what the judge is waiting on before making a ruling.  Please keep praying!   Pray with our team that we are able to begin new simple churches in the communities where we live.  The Sanfords have had people agree to come, but then do not show up.  We are still praying for God to send us a person of peace.  John has asked a few people, but without any positive response at this time.   Thank you praying as Cheryl traveled to Japan and back.  Her trip there with the school board was very beneficial and all went well.  This week we will travel to the south end of the island for a few days of rest with our teammates Chris & Samantha Sanford.   Thank you for praying for our ministry.   God Bless,   John & Cheryl     1.  Please pray that we continue to fear the Lord and worship Him as He deserves. 2.  Please pray for Ted Skiles as he recuperates and waits for his next surgery. 3.  Please pray for Ellinor’s adoption to finish soon so she can be with her forever family. 4.  Please pray that our team can begin new simple churches near where we live. 5.  Thank you for praying for our safety.
